A team won 7 of it’s 12 games. What fraction of its game did the team win?

7/12 games the team won and if you wanted to find the opposite of that it would be 5/12 games the team lost.

The distance from his home to his work place is 118.125 miles

<h3>How to find the distance from his home to his work place?</h3>

He drove from home to work at an average speed of 45 mph. Therefore,

speed = 45 mph

let

time = x

speed = distance / time

distance = 45x

His return trip home took 45 minutes longer because he could only drive at 35 mph. Therefore,

45 minutes = 0.75 hours

distance = 35(x + 0.75)

distance = 35x + 26.25

Therefore,

45x = 35x + 26.25

45x - 35x = 26.25

10x = 26.25

x = 26.25 / 10

x = 2.625

Therefore,

distance = 45(2.625) = 118.125 miles

Find the 20th, 40th, 60th, and 80th percentiles of the standard normal distribution. Round the answers to two decimal places.
Fed [463]
To answer the question above, we have to use the z-score percentile table for the standard normal distribution. It shows:
The 20th percentile  =  - 0.84
The 40th percentile  =  - 0.25
The 60th percentile  =    0.25
The 80th percentile  =    0.84
